CW03 EXA is a 2003 Hyundai Coupe in Black with a 2,656c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.1%.
Across all 2003 Hyundai Coupe models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.6% with a typical mileage of 63,455 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Hyundai Coupe f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 42,931 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CW03 EXA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Hyundai Coupe typ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 23 years old, this Hyundai Coupe is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
